本地转移MYSQL数据目录方法
本帖最后由 李惟 于 2011-05-24 19:56 编辑问题:今天遇到一个问题,查询数据的时候出现这样的错误提示。直接desc table也出现这个错,但数据查询正常。ERROR 1030 Got error 28 from storage engine查了下发现出现这个问题主要有两个情况:[*]操作系统的/tmp/目录已经是100%,删除一些临时文件后,恢复正常![*]磁盘满了,没有多余的磁盘空间进行读写
第一种问题已经提供解决方法了,这里主要说说第二种方法的解决办法
如何转移数据所在的目录?我的MYSQL 数据目录默认是安装在系统盘,因为系统盘本身不大。我需要将所有的数据转移到我的E盘,步骤如下[*]停止MYSQL服务,……bin>net stop mysql
详细方法可以查看【重启MySQL的正确方法】[*]将C盘数据拷贝到E盘指定目录[*]修改my.ini, 找到datadir=”{你拷贝的目录位置}”[*]启动MYSQL服务,……bin>net start mysql
详细方法可以查看【重启MySQL的正确方法】 这个是windows版本的简单,LINUX就麻烦了,可能会导致服务启动不了,特别是源码安装的。
页:
[1]